Output 34292bd960f02343d366ea4f9c67313054d35a63bab71d17c76a4acd265babaa:22

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20c723b284f130d6a74a72c888cedc5daa0f980 OP_EQUAL
address
3HvT7U5o5wWUmdu9nYi8jt7pvh9TdNXLfs
transaction
34292bd960f02343d366ea4f9c67313054d35a63bab71d17c76a4acd265babaa
spent
true